Question 2

The chi-square test requires that the expected frequency in each cell of the contingency table be at least 30.
 
 Indicate whether the statement is true or false

Answer to Question 2

F
The expected frequency in each cell should be at least 5.

Your skin wrinkles if you stay in the bathtub a long time because the outermost layer of skin (which consists of dead keratin) swells when it absorbs water. It is tightly attached to the skin below it, so it compensates for the increased area by wrinkling. This happens to the hands and feet because they have the thickest layer of dead keratin cells.
